I don't think a law is inappropriate, and cutting power to a data center is a fair example. But that isn't what this bill does. It requires companies to be able to stop inference, cut off user access and throttle compute allocation. Those are all things they already do to run their own services. Nothing in it touches the grid, and nothing in it reaches open weight models at all.

My concern is with what the government gets, not with what the companies have to build.

There is a provision requiring companies to be able to suspend an account or a user that the Secretary identifies as a risk, and that includes a risk of violating the company's own terms of service. Once an incident has happened somewhere, DHS can order it. The order takes effect immediately, asking them to reconsider does not pause it, they get five days to answer, and after that you are filing in the DC Circuit. What gets reported along the way is exempt from FOIA and from state open records law.

To be frank I worry about mankind and its lust for power more than I worry about the AI. History has not been kind to people who assumed emergency powers would stay narrow or get handed back.
